PharMerica
OverviewThe Pharmacy Automation Support Specialist works under the supervision of Manager, Automation primarily supporting pharmacy backend distribution and system integration with automated dispensing machines. This role requires a combination of technical expertise, analytical skills, and excellent communication abilities.
The ideal candidate will have a minimum of 3 years of experience in non-retail pharmacy operations. Must be able to install, maintain, and support on-site pharmacy equipment.
Travel: 50-75%
Remote: Able to reside anywhere within the Continental USA.
Schedule: Monday - Friday, hours are per business needs.

Responsibilities Assists with automated dispensing machine integrationsProficient in dispense methods and pharmacy workflow associated with pharmacy automationSupports the installation of new units and relocation of existing unitsGathers, analyzes, and interprets data, detects patterns, makes recommendations surrounding machine optimizationConducts regular performance reports and formulary reviews for automated dispensing machinesProactively identify opportunities for process optimization and automation system enhancementsTrains on staff on troubleshooting, best practices, cleaning procedures, preventive maintenance tasks, and ticketing protocolsMonitors use of system and machines ensuring proper utilization, adherence to policy and procedureProvides ongoing support and guidance to Pharmacy Automation Technicians to optimize machine performance and minimize downtime Qualifications High School diploma required/ Associate Degree or greater preferred3+ years as an Operator or higher on commercially available or proprietary pharmacy system focused on Long Term Care or Institutional pharmacyFoundational knowledge in Institutional or Long-term Care PharmacyCommunication – IntermediateMicrosoft Office Suite – IntermediateDevoted to a task or purpose with integrityCurious, detail-oriented, and a quick learnerCapable of carrying out a given task with all details necessary to get the task done wellDemonstrates eagerness and interestWorks well as a member of a teamDetail-oriented mindset with a commitment to upholding quality standards and best practices.Inspired to perform well by the ability to contribute to the success of a project and the organizationStrong customer focus, ability to deeply understand customers and their needsExcellent communication skills
About our Line of Business PharMerica, an affiliate of BrightSpring Health Services, delivers personalized pharmacy care through dedicated local teams, serving health care providers such as skilled nursing facilities, senior living communities, and hospitals. We also cater to individuals with behavioral needs, infusion therapy needs, seniors receiving in-home care, and patients with cancer. Operating long-term care, home infusion, and specialty pharmacies across the nation, we combine the personal touch of a neighborhood pharmacy with the resources of a national network. Our comprehensive solutions, backed by industry-leading technology and regulatory expertise, ensure accurate medication access, cost control, and compliance with best-in-class clinical standards.
